#593511 Hex Color Code

#593511

The Hexadecimal Color #593511 is a contrast shade of Saddle Brown. #593511 RGB value is rgb(89, 53, 17). RGB Color Model of #593511 consists of 34% red, 20% green and 6% blue. HSL color Mode of #593511 has 30°(degrees) Hue, 68% Saturation and 21% Lightness. #593511 color has an wavelength of 601.11111n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#593511 is #666633.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#593511 is #531. The Closest Color to #593511 is #8B4513. Official Name of #593511 Hex Code is Jambalaya.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#593511 is 0 Cyan 40 Magenta 81 Yellow 65 Black and #593511 CMY is 0, 40, 81.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#593511 is hsl(30,68,21,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(30, 81, 35).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#593511 is 5.49, 4.71, 1.15.
Hex8 Value of #593511 is #593511FF. Decimal Value of #593511 is 5846289 and Octal Value of #593511 is 26232421. Binary Value of #593511 is 1011001, 110101, 10001 and Android of #593511 is 4284036369 / 0xff593511.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#593511 is 0.484, 0.415, 0.415 and YIQ Color Space of #593511 is 59.66, 33.0192, -3.5892.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#593511 is 5.86, 4.14, 1.21.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#593511 is 25.89, 12.71, 28.35.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#593511 is 25.89, 26.28, 21.63.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#593511 is 25.89, 31.07, 65.85. Hunter Lab variable of #593511 is 21.7, 7.17, 12.05.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#593511

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
